BBC Sport presenter Mark Chapman was left scratching his head on Celebrity Catchphrase after struggling to guess a well-known saying in the final round.
Viewers were shouting at their telly screens as the well-known face stumbled over a baffling brainteaser in the final round.

Mark appeared on the ITV gameshow hosted by Stephen Mulhern in a bid to raise money for charity.
After making it through to the final round, Mark had his skills put to one final test, going against the clock to answer questions on the catchphrase pyramid.
The 51-year-old, best known for hosting Match of the Day 2 and BBC Radio 5 Live, was left stumbling over his words as the clock ticked down.
But would you have any luck?
In the clue, Mr Chips was filling up his white van with petrol.
The gauge went from E for empty to full, which had an icon of a brown cowboy hat.
Mark made several unsuccessful guesses from 'full gallon' to 'filling the tank' to 'one gallon hat'.
Do you get it?
The answer was: It's full to the brim.
Mark was unfortunately unable to figure it out in the timeframe, though he didn't go home empty-handed, earning an incredible £14,000 for his chosen charity.

Mark and Kelly Cates were announced as Gary Lineker's Match of the Day replacements in January, with Gabby Logan making up the new-look trio.
Lineker's BBC exit has sparked a battle between his three successors over who will lead the World Cup coverage, SunSport exclusively revealed.
Insiders said that the three also be competing to take the main presenting job for next year's FA Cup Final.

Lineker earned a staggering FOUR TIMES more than his Match of the Day successor Mark Chapman last season.
The BBC have published their annual salaries list, with Lineker, 64, far and away their top earner in 2023-24.
The former England striker spent 26 years as MOTD host and saw his pay reach a whopping £1.35 million per year.
Mark pocketed a cool £325,000 last year for his work with the BBC, which included 120 episodes of Radio 5 Live, the Olympics, Euro 2024 and, of course, Match of the Day 2.
Despite his array of stellar work, 'Chappers' earned more than £1m LESS than his MOTD predecessor, Lineker - who officially quit the BBC in June - last year alone.

Ozzy Osbourne and Sharon Osbourne took part in a press conference back in 2004 in which they spoke about two men having burgled at their home in Buckinghamshire The late Ozzy Osbourne once confronted a brazen burglar who broke into his home while Sharon slept. The singer-songwriter was said to have come face-to-face with the masked intruder in the middle of the night before they made off with jewellery. Ozzy, who died, aged 76, yesterday, and his wife Sharon Osbourne, now 72, were reportedly asleep when two men broke into their home in Buckinghamshire in 2004. They were said to have fled with jewellery worth an estimated £1 million, and the incident led to a police appeal involving the couple. It was reported at the time that the burglary took place after Ozzy and Sharon returned home from a birthday party in London for Sir Elton John 's husband, David Furnish. They were said to have been asleep when the intruders entered their home. Ozzy stumbled into one of the burglars when he got up to use the bathroom at around 4am. The Black Sabbath legend, who was reportedly naked at the time, was then said to have held the assailant in a headlock before they fled by jumping from a first-floor window. It was suggested that the intruders had bypassed a security system at the home. They were said to have got in through the first floor and went through various rooms before making off with a "substantial" haul of jewellery. The haul was said to have included a 10 carat diamond ring given to Sharon two years prior when she renewed her wedding vows with Ozzy. Insurers reportedly put up a £100,000 reward over the stolen items, thought to be worth £1 million. During a press conference, Ozzy said: "When I had a go at the assailant, as I said earlier on, I acted purely on impulse. In hindsight, it could've been a lot worse. I could have been like George Harrison [who was once stabbed by an intruder]. I could have been badly injured or shot or anything." Ozzy said that things could have "got really ugly". As reported in footage from the time shared by ITN Archive, when asked if he would tackle a burglar again, Ozzy responded at the press conference: "Is the Pope a Catholic?" Sharon also gave details about her ring, which was reportedly stolen from a bedside table. She said: "[Ozzy] always said I was a perfect 10 [and] that when he had the money he would buy me a 10-carat diamond ring and he did." Years later, it was reported that a ring had been recovered after their daughter Kelly Osbourne, now 40, spotted it on the BBC's Crimewatch in 2011. It came following an appeal on the TV show for owners of stolen items to come forward after South Yorkshire Police recovered some jewellery. It was suggested at the time that none of the other items said to have been stolen from the Osbournes were part of the recovered lot. Kelly however said Sharon was in tears over seeing her ring. She wrote on X: "Thank you crime watch my mum is over the moon that's her wedding ring she cried with joy because she can get it back! Thank you!"
